housenumbervalidator

Uzytkownik gulp21 napisal skrypt szukajacy podwójnych numerów domów, sprawdzajacy kody pocztowe i pisownie nazw ulic.

Link: http://gulp21.bplaced.net/osm/housenumbervalidator.php.txt

Nie testowalem tego, moze ktos z Was sie temu przyjrzy…

Na tę chwilę ten walidator chyba nie działa, bo nie wykrył mi błędów, które celowo wprowadziłem dla testów.


zibi@amd64 /home/zibi $ php housenumbervalidator.php temp.osm
Lines: 4409 temp.osm
---
NOCOUNTRY
---
NOCITY
---
NOPOSTCODE
---
NOSTREET
---
NONUMBER
---
POSTCODES
PHP Warning:  array_combine(): Both parameters should have at least 1 element in/home/zibi/housenumbervalidator.php on line 284

Warning: array_combine(): Both parameters should have at least 1 element in /home/zibi/housenumbervalidator.php on line 284
PHP Warning:  Invalid argument supplied for foreach() in /home/zibi/housenumbervalidator.php on line 284

Warning: Invalid argument supplied for foreach() in /home/zibi/housenumbervalidator.php on line 284

finished after 1 seconds

gulp21

pyta, czy móglbys mu podeslac do testowania dane OSM w których walidator nie dziala, bo u niego chodzi…

Wysłałem do niego maila.
Jakby co, bardzo prosty pliczek z kilkoma wybrakowanymi numerami jest tu: http://www.openstreetmap.org.pl/zibi/input.osm